#1258e3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1258e3 is composed of 7.1% red, 34.5%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.1% cyan, 61.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 219.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 48%. #1258e3 color hex could be obtained by blending #24b0ff with #0000c7.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1258e3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1258e3 has RGB values of R:18, G:88,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1202403.
